Renggin Apal - Dambo Rongjeng, East Garo Hills
Renggin Apal is a village situated in the Dambo Rongjeng subdivision of East Garo Hills district, Meghalaya. It is located approximately 16 km from the tehsil headquarters in Dambo Rongjeng and around 82 km from the district headquarters in Williamnagar.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Renggin Apal is 274798. The village falls under the 794110 pincode.
Renggin Apal village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system. For political representation, the village falls under the Rongjeng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Tura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Renggin Apal
According to the 2011 Census, Renggin Apal village had a total population of 57 people, including 25 males and 32 females, living in 11 households. The sex ratio was 1,280 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 61.70%, with male literacy at 62.50% and female literacy at 60.87%. The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 53.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 57 | 25 | 32 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 10 | 1 | 9 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 53 | 22 | 31 |
| Literate Population | 29 | 15 | 14 |
| Illiterate Population | 28 | 10 | 18 |

Transport and Connectivity of Renggin Apal
Public transport in the Renggin Apal is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. the road distance from Williamnagar to Renggin Apal is about 82 km, with the usual travel time around ~2.3 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
